Review: Ugetsu from Art Blakey's Jazz Messengers is a live album put out originally by Riverside Records in October 1963. It features six cuts - although more were said to have been played on the night, but didn't fit on the record - and all are played by Blakey on drums, Freddie Hubbard on trumpet, Curtis Fuller on trombone, Wane Shorter on tenor sax, Cedar Walton on piano and Reggie Workman on double bass. It's a straight-up jazz set with classics like 'I Didn't Know What Time It Was' sounding all the better for being live and direct.

Review: Clifford Brown is one of history's finest trumpet payers. Here he adds his style to nine engaging tunes recorded in 1955 with the Max Roach Quintet. One of the leading hard bop gangs of the time, tenor saxophonist Harold Land, pianist Richie Powell, and bassist George Morrow all featured and gave rise to these lively and energetic cuts. The likes of 'Cherokee' certainly blow away any cobwebs with the fluid and florid trumpets dancing over sizzling drums, and the more swinging (and excellently named) 'Gerkin For Perkin' is super short but sweet.

Review: Hailing from Richmond, Virginia, Butcher Brown are a five-piece band with a solid run of heavy-grooving records behind them, but they're switching things up on this new record for Concord Jazz. The album finds band member Tennishu leading as he grips the mic for a big band approach to hip-hop which draws on the band's considerable skills to render a widescreen twist on rap with more than a little jazz informing the sound. Nodding to past hip-hop legends (shouting out Biggie Smalls on 'Unbelievable', for example) but bringing their own bold and brassy sound to the fore, this is an assured and hard-funking record with mass appeal.

Review: For rock fans, Creedence Clearwater Revival's show at London's Royal Albert Hall in 1970 is legendary. Now, all these years later, it gets an official release that features the much-talked-about live show in all its glory. Enduring hits as 'Fortunate Son', 'Proud Mary' and 'Bad Moon Rising' all feature and the audio has been restored and mixed by Giles Martin and engineer Sam Okell. As well as the album dropping, there is also a documentary concert film Travelin' Band: Creedence Clearwater Revival at the Royal Albert Hall which has been narrated by Jeff Bridges and directed by Bob Smeaton. Well worth checking.

Review: 'You Must Believe In Spring' is the celebrated 70th studio album from pioneering jazz pianist Bill Evans. Now remastered by the legendary artist of the trade Kevin Gray for Concord, the smoking, kiss-curled jazz piano great gets a full-on reminisce in stereo, this time charting his dextrous, chromatic ivory-straddling as part of a trio, with Eddie Gomnez on bass and Eliot Zigmund on drums. Soft, pining and full of harmonic curiosities and indistinct tempi, it includes a range of Evans' originals and covers, including Frank Laico's 'You Must Believe In Spring' and Johnny Mandel's 'Theme From M*A*S*H*'.

Review: Long based sax supremo Nubya Garcia's debut album was a real thing of beauty so it only makes sense it now gets revisited by a team of super remixers for this special Record Store Day release. Presented on limited edition turquoise marbled vinyl it opens with Makaya McCraven's airy and floaty light remix of 'Source' before DJ Tahira layers up 'Stand With Each Other' with ethno-grooves that are loose and off kilter. That tumbledown vibe continues on the scruffy deep house version of 'Together Is A Beautiful Place To Be' by Shy One before big jazz house feels from Mark De Clive-Lowe close things down.

Review: Nubya Garcia is one of the icons of the current, thriving jazz scene. Her album Source was a deserving Mercury Prize-nominee and here she reworks it through a series of new collars with the likes of DJ Harrison, Moses Boyd, Dengue Dengue Dengue and Georgia Anne Muldrow. Each of the new versions retains plenty of the soul and invention of the originals but adds in a range of other influences that take them in a more driving, groove-orientated direction. The results are stunning, with plenty of great options for DJs who like to play slow and sensuous. The Kaidi Tatham remix of 'La Cumbia Me Esta Llamando' is our personal pick.

Review: Robert Grasper very much announced his arrival on the world stage with Black Radio 1. And Black Radio 2 only took him into the stratosphere. Both records proved him to be a master of hip hop, broken beat and jazz and able to call upon some of the biggest names in those scene from Jill Scott to Erykah Badu. Both of those timeless records, as the title suggest, are steeped in Black music traditions and so is this third one. Here the award winning Glasper (nine Grammy nominations and four wins) works with modern greats such as Gregory Porter, Q Tip, BJ The Chicago Kid, Ty Dolla Sign and many more to cook up another powerful statement for these troubled times.

Review: There are few finer alto-sax players in the world than Art Pepper. By the time of his death run 1982 his legacy was already assured after a fantastic run of albums such as his standout Art Pepper Meets The Rhythm Section. Plus 11 is right up there too, though: the 1960 jazz record saw Art work with an ensemble of 11 other musicians arranged by Marty Paich. It's one of a number dates the two played together that year but the only one with Pepper leading. Pepper's clarinet performance on 'Anthropology' and the alternate takes of 'Walkin'' are real standouts.

Review: A quarter of century has now passed since the release of Up, R.E.M's 11th studio album. It was a set that perplexed some critics on its original release in 1998, in part because it was more experimental in tone (while remaining a fine, song-based set) and saw the band employ drum machines and electronic instrumentation to expand their sound palette. As this anniversary reissue proves, Up has aged well and is arguably ripe for reappraisal by those critics who initially panned it. Even so, what makes this double-disc celebratory edition special is CD2, which boasts an 11-track recording of a surprise set the band played in Los Angeles in early 1999. As well as featuring fine versions of tracks from the album ('Daysleeper', 'Lotus'), we're also treated to storming run throughs of such favourites as 'Losing My Religion', 'Man On The Moon' and 'It's The End of the World As We Know It'.

Review: Yet another first time reissue of a classic, Mongo Santamaria's 'Sofrito'. Don't be confused by the pico de gallo on the front cover; this isn't a salsa album, but rather a career-defining jazz, Afro-Cuban music and funk selection of delights. First released in 1976, it was the master conguero's (conga player's) most defining album, and now gets a proper remaster by Kevin Gray.

Review: Preceded by a single of the same name last year, The Tipping Point marks the return of one of the most inventive pop groups to ever do it. In the 1980s, Tears For Fears expanded the possibilities of what a commercial song could be with sophisticated songwriting, unabashed bombast, unexpected curveballs and jaw-dropping hooks. Given the influence they've had, they might not sound so revolutionary amongst the generations of pop acts who have followed their lead, but they return vital and full of purpose. Embracing new sonics but staying true to the songwriting as the central focus of the Curt Smith and Roland Orzabal's project, it's a triumphant return from a truly seminal group.

Review: Whether you're reading this and thinking Christmas seems a way off, or here because there's a next day delivery and time is ticking, A Charlie Brown Christmas is quite possibly one of the most exquisite scores to the silly season you're likely to come across. Better yet, it's a complete curveball, with this Peanuts cartoon score hardly topping the list when it comes to famous Yuletide music.

Sophisticated stuff, imagine slow drinks in a late night jazz bar. Surprisingly sexy, refined, laidback to the point where you can almost see flames dancing in a fireplace, and shadows licking at the walls. Of course, we do get 'Hark, The Herald Angels Sing' and 'Christmas Time Is Here', taking us back to the best parts of school age winters gone by, both delivered via vocal choirs. But, overall, this is a truly tasteful example of how to do festive well.

Review: The pianist Vince Guaraldi released 'Impressions Of Black Orpheus' in 1962, in response to the film 'Black Orpheus' - the Brazilian film by Marcel Camus. The film had taken the world by storm three years earlier: a contemporary retelling of the Ovidian story of Orfeu and Eurydice, its soundtrack had the unintended effect of introducing the distinct sound of bossa nova to the world. The reinterpretation of the soundtrack by Guaraldi's trio here gets an expansion via Concord, with new unreleased recordings takung up a mammoth, complementary four new sides of vinyl.
